Transaction 004bfbefbfa802eafa6992075355ddc09775bf52357076ebda1a60e27cc32777

1 Input
2 Outputs
  • 004bfbefbfa802eafa6992075355ddc09775bf52357076ebda1a60e27cc32777:0
  • value  507619
    address  3BxpmdKXBd9qpqTbRLSm467mT77QfRNxRG
  • 004bfbefbfa802eafa6992075355ddc09775bf52357076ebda1a60e27cc32777:1
  • value  23353274
    address  1N19ezEfDuRFZ79VoLkqqLPpmF9wLZB536